Why are the negative numbers included?

When you multiply two negative numbers together, you get a positive number. That means both the positive and negative numbers are factors of 31,122,403.

Example:
1 x 31,122,403 = 31,122,403
and
-1 x -31,122,403 = 31,122,403
Notice both answers equal 31,122,403
